- The distance between Tuktoyaktuk, NT, Canada and Taiyuan, China is approximately 10,623 km or 6,602 mi.
- To reach Tuktoyaktuk, NT in this distance one would set out from Taiyuan bearing 355.5°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Tuktoyaktuk, NT bearing 185.1° or S .
- Tuktoyaktuk, NT has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Taiyuan has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Tuktoyaktuk, NT is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Taiyuan is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The mean temperature is 20.1 °C (36.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.2 °C (16.6°F) more in Tuktoyaktuk, NT.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 314.8 mm (12.4 in) less which is equivalent to 314.8 l/m² (7.73 US gal/ft²) or 3,148,000 l/ha (336,542 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9° lower in Tuktoyaktuk, NT than in Taiyuan.
